I work for an ISP.
I am looking to find out where this site determines the values for Type and Assignment:
Hostname: 142.164.176.1
ISP: Stentor National Integrated Communications Network
Organization: Stentor National Integrated Communications Network
Proxy: None detected
**Type: Broadband
**Assignment: Static IP
The above is correct and works for my mail server.
I have another IP Address for a mail server and it shows up as:
**Type: Unknown
**Assignment: Dynamic IP
When I use this IP Address some of the SPAM sites block mail coming from this IP Address as they say it is a Dynamic IP Address when it is in fact a Static IP Address.
What do I need to update in order for my new IP Address to show up as Broadband and Static IP?
